MAIN REQUIREMENTS
• Detection and classification of entities, relations and facts with good F1
• Long, high quality texts vs. short texts with bad / missing grammar in multiple languages
• Training not by linguists but domain experts
• Flexible adaption to new domains and contexts
• Many different data sources

GETTING AN OVERVIEW
• Understood domain by reviewing 30+ tools and frameworks
• Findings• Startups and huge enterprises usually stick to Deep Learning (DL) high flexibility
• Some existing companies loss market share, e.g., Attensity
• Market saturation in U.S., only less companies in Europe (5)
• More and more NLP-as-a-Service
• Only a few use RDF data, e.g., for output or disambiguation (8)
• Only 8 tools could extract relations and facts
• Only 9 open source tools with available benchmarks

MINER – CORPUS CREATION
• 1 corpus per language / dialect required
• the larger and more heterogeneous the better get and model more contexts for words
• Sources: Common Crawl, Wikipedia, news feeds, domain specific texts, Twitter, …

MINER – SUPERVISED MODEL
• Sequence labeling task• use a bi-directional LSTM
(BLSTM)
• Gated Recurrent Unit (GRU) as specialized LSTM
• Output layer• join and normalize
• classification

MINER – IMPLEMENTATION
• Torch framework• matured, efficient GPU support, good packages for neural networks, …
• Scripting with Lua language
• Service implementation with Go because of great integration with Lua
• Integrated in Ontos Eiger workbench

MINER – IMPLEMENTATION
• English News• ~ 400 English texts from CoNLL 2003 and news feeds
• 5 entity types defined and manually annotated by 2 experts
• 1st value: correct start of entity
• 2nd value: correct end of entity
Class: Person Organization Product Location EventPer class F1:....... 0.976 | 0.990 0.932 | 0.962 0.873 | 0.942 0.958 | 0.976 0.891 | 0.928Per class Recall:... 0.974 | 0.988 0.936 | 0.953 0.845 | 0.926 0.965 | 0.980 0.870 | 0.913Per class Precision: 0.978 | 0.992 0.928 | 0.971 0.902 | 0.959 0.951 | 0.973 0.914 | 0.944

WILDHORN NLP PIPELINE
• Implementation• Apache Spark 1.6 & Confluent 3.0
• Use of Spark Jobserver to manageApache Spark applications
• Ontos Eiger backend ready
• First tests• Simple Mesos cluster with 3 servers
• ~ 1000 message / sec with 1 broker without MINER analytics: no data problem
• Problem: 1 MINER instance currently scales up to 100 message / sec

LESSONS LEARNED
• Neural networks / deep learning provide great concepts & frameworks for flexible, high quality NLP tasks
• Apache Kafka / Confluent Platform in combination with Apache Spark good foundation for data streaming and processing
• Disambiguation and linking of entities to taxonomies and Knowledge Graphs via Semantic Web technologies is a core contribution for data integration
• Hard to find employees with Deep Learning skills
